I hired a capsule from the red cross (a bargain $50 for 3 months), which was fabulous for the purpose of not disturbing bub when asleep- especially in that first month when they sleep heaps and are little enough to carry in the capsule easily. However it was an old model and rather awkward- therefore we took bub out of it before he reached 3 months and put him in his safe n sound car seat. He is much more comfortable in his car seat, but I quite regret not spending the extra on a new plush capsule. My sister-in-law has one and they are fantastic. Of course they also double as a mini-rocker/seat when you visit family and friends houses.
We try really hard not to wake bub when getting him out of his car seat- but to no avail. Then of course we have to go to the hassle of getting his pram out of the car as he needs something to fall asleep in when we visit others. For the next bub I will definitely be buying a new capsule and will utilise it for as long as possible.
